How Rapper Net Worth Is Determined
Net worth for ultra-high-net-worth individuals in music combines audited earnings, market-based valuations, and publicly reported holdings. For rappers, major categories include:
- Record royalties and streaming payouts
- Label and publishing equity
- Endorsements, apparel, and consumer brands
- Real estate and liquid investments
- Tech, media, and venture stakes
Because private asset holdings are rarely disclosed in full, estimates vary by source. We prioritize data from audited financial disclosures, reputable business outlets, and legal filings where available, clearly distinguishing between reported figures and approximated ranges.
Valuation Methodology Highlights
Valuations for music catalogs, fashion lines, and equity stakes rely on revenue multiples, discounted cash flow models, and recent comparable transactions. When a rapper exits or enters a partnership, those events reset assumptions. We note the date of each major valuation event and the source type to keep comparisons consistent across artists.
